Introduction

Ethisphere International is an international group which researches and analyzes the practices of companies related to business ethics, sustainability, and social responsibility. This body promotes positive practices related to corporate ethics and good relationships with all the stakeholders. World's most ethical companies' recognition, Ethisphere magazine, Ethisphere Inside Certification, Anti-Corruption Program Verification, and Compliance Leader Verification

are some of the initiatives of the group to ensure that companies around the world consider ethics as an integral part of doing business (Ethisphere Inc, 2013).

Ethisphere issued a list of World's most ethical companies for the year 2013. According to the advisory and selection panels, the methodology of selecting the most ethical companies included five important factors which were ethics and compliance program, corporate citizenship and responsibility, culture of ethics, governance, and reputation, leadership and innovation. These factors cover almost every aspect which can ensure that the operations and philosophy of a company are in the boundaries of ethical standards. PepsiCo was declared as one of the most ethical company this year.

Moral Responsibility

Consumers

It is evident that serving customer morally and respectfully is mandatory for a company to survive in the intense competition. PepsiCo also has to focus on satisfying the needs and demand of the customers in a way that is moral and ethical. The company executives have always kept customer satisfaction as a primary concern, and policies in which the responsibilities towards customers has been mentioned and emphasized.

PepsiCo has developed a worldwide code of conduct which defines the mode of operations done in every market and the ethical standards that should be followed by every employee of the company. In this policy, it has been mentioned that the customers should be treated in an honest, fair, and objective manner. It also stresses that no unfair or deceptive practice should be done with the customers and their respect should be the most important thing (PepsiCo, 2013).

Global Reporting Initiative of PepsiCo has also developed the practice of taking feedback and surveys from customers which are conducted by the GlobeScan and others. This initiative provides insight from customers about the practices that customers feel as unethical. PepsiCo also respects the right of consumer privacy and ensures that customers details remain private in all the operational and promotional activities of the company.
